Property Report
This 42 square meter end-terrace flat in Hampton, TW12 3QJ, was built between 1983-1990 and features fully double-glazed windows. The property has a current energy rating of 'C' and a potential energy efficiency of 75%. The main fuel is mains gas, and the heating system consists of a boiler and radiators. The property has undergone some energy-saving measures, with an estimated annual energy cost saving of £561.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 986 out of 999.
